源代码
推荐下载源代码,帮助你亲身体验发布NFT。
https://github.com/zengxinhai/issue-NFT-on-Aptos
先决条件
你需要知道一些Typescript就可以开始了,确保你已经安装了node。
创建项目
创建一个空项目并进行一些init操作:
安装必须的包:
2023香港Web3嘉年华“Web3.0 Demo Day”公布首批16个入选项目:3月26日消息,由万向区块链实验室、HashKey Group联合主办,数码港作为支持单位的“Web3.0应用展示日(Demo Day)”分会场活动将于4月14日-15日香港Web3嘉年华活动期间在香港会议展览中心(Sub-stage1)举行,该活动由ETH VC和MetaWeb Ventures提供技术支持。
目前已确认加入的首批项目为0xScope、BCDEx、BlockSec、Chatpuppy、Coinsdo、Createra、dappOS、DeSchool、Gameland、Mail3、Opside、Pawnfi、PlutoStudio、Portkey、Voty、xBank,项目类型涵盖Web3基础设施、DeFi、社交媒体、游戏、公链等多条赛道。[2023/3/26 13:27:25]
创建typescript参数:
Wemade将发行区块链棒球游戏R1B:金色财经报道,Wemade将发行区块链棒球游戏Round 1 Baseball。用户可以通过游戏收集 \"金钱球 \"实用代币,并通过投注获得 \"R1 \"代币。\"R1 \"是可在R1B和R1元区使用的治理令牌。该游戏正处于开发的最后阶段,预计将于2023年底在全球推出。[2023/3/2 12:38:42]
确保启用resolveJsonModule,
禁用strictNullChecks。
准备静态文件
图片制作一个资产文件夹来放置collection的logo和图片。在这里,我们有一个logo图像,在token图像子文件夹中有两个token图像。
Token元数据
创建一个元数据文件夹,用于放置集合中每个token的元数据。下面是token元数据的示例。
FTX CEO:很高兴看到部分实体拥有“具偿付能力的资产负债表”:11月20日消息,FTX全球资产战略审查已启动,FTX新任CEOJohn J.RayIII在一份声明中表示:根据我们过去一周的审查,我们很高兴地了解到,FTX在美国境内外的许多受监管或许可的子公司都拥有偿付能力良好的资产负债表、负责任的管理和有价值的特许经营权。
根据声明,被称为'FTX债务人'(FTXDebtors)的FTX相关公司已启用PerellaWeinbergPartnersLP作为牵头投资银行,并开始准备出售或重组一些资产。Ray表示:我已经指示FTXDebtors的团队在困难情况下尽可能优先考虑保留特许经营权价值。
FTX债务人已向破产法院提出各种动议,寻求法院的临时救济,如果获得批准,将运行新的全球现金管理系统和付款程序。听证会定于11月22日举行。(Fortune)[2022/11/20 22:08:20]
名称:描述将被市场用于在网站上显示信息。
用户将使用属性根据不同的特征进行过滤。
图像将显示给用户。我们将在将图像上传到IPFS后填充它。
现在我们有这样的文件夹结构:
彭博社:富达投资等曾致信美CFTC支持FTX衍生品交易计划:11月16日消息,据彭博社报道,FTX此前曾申请一项有争议的计划,希望获得监管机构批准,以允许其衍生品交易平台使用通过算法产生的保证金直接与投资者进行交易,而不是传统的金融中介机构(如经纪人)。该计划是让FTX在全天每隔10秒计算一次保证金水平,而不是传统的每天计算一次且只在常规交易日计算一次,抵押不足的头寸将自动清算,旨在彻底改变衍生品交易。
而从富达投资(Fidelity Investments)、Fortress Investment Group、Susquehanna International Group和Virtu Financial,到乔治敦大学、芝加哥大学、威廉玛丽学院和斯坦福大学的教职员工,再到律师事务所Jones Day和Heritage Foundation智库的数百封支持FTX计划的公开信在今年送到了美国商品期货交易委员会(CFTC)。[2022/11/16 13:10:54]
在IPFS上托管资产
这里我们使用nft.storage将文件上传到IPFS
NFTUp工具
下载地址:https://nft.storage/docs/how-to/nftup/
外媒:成本上升币价下跌,比特币矿商正在减产:6月16日消息,比特币矿商正在缩减产量,加密货币价格下跌和能源成本上升挤压了其利润,导致其股价暴跌。报道指出,比特币矿商使用强大的计算机创建新的比特币单位,并在区块链上验证交易,它们被迫改变策略,因为加密货币价格暴跌可能会削弱它们在技术方面的巨额投资。
Blockchain.com的数据显示,比特币哈希率自本周初以来下降了4%。这一下跌表明,数字挖矿者投入到破解复杂谜题的算力减少了,矿商破解这些谜题所获得的奖励是新铸造的比特币。支付给矿商的收入总额降至近一年来的最低水平。哈萨克矿商、矿业公司Xive的联合创始人迪达尔·贝克巴乌夫表示,他正在“适应新的价格和现实”,一旦比特币跌破2.5万美元,他就关闭不盈利的采矿业务。(金融时报中文网)[2022/6/16 4:32:08]
按照其步骤设置帐户以及如何上传资产。
上传资产
上传token-images文件夹,然后我们可以为token元数据填充image字段。为您的所有令牌元数据执行此操作。
填写完token元数据的所有信息后,上传元数据文件夹。
最后上传logo图片。
设置元数据、版税、token配置
在项目根文件夹中创建一个nft-config.json,我们将使用这些信息供以后使用。以下内容:
您可以根据需要调整配置。有几点需要明确:
takeRate:提成的百分比,5代表5%。
feerreceiver:收取特许权使用费的地址
maxSupply:此集合的最大供应
设置Aptos帐户
我们需要一个Aptos帐户来与区块链交互。如果您没有帐户,您可以使用Petra钱包生成一个帐户。
用一些$APT代币为您的账户提供资金,1$APT代币应该足够了,你可以在币安上购买。
使用typescript铸造NFT?
在项目根目录中创建一个src文件夹来包含所有的源代码,还需要一个.env文件来存储PRIV_KEY,以防止提交到gitrepo。
account.ts?
在src文件夹下创建account.ts。以下内容:
从.env文件中获取私钥
转换为Unit8Array
初始化帐户,并导出供以后使用。
chain.ts
创建链。SRC文件夹下的Ts。内容如下:
在这里,我们获得tokenClient与Aptos区块链交互,
以及一个帮助函数fundAccountForDev来获得$APT用于开发目的。
isMainnet标志用于打开/关闭主网交互。
issue_NFT.ts
创建issue_NFT.SRC文件夹下的Ts。内容如下:
上面的代码创建了一个集合,并在该集合下创建了1个token,以下是需要了解的几点:
您只能创建一个具有相同名称的集合。
如果你设置CHAIN_NET=main,你将需要用$APT为你的账户提供资金来制造token
测试NFT
在package.json中添加一个命令。
运行以下命令:
npmrunissueNFT
如果没有任何问题,那么你已经发出了NFT
如果你在主网上发布的,你可以去topaz.so看看你的NFT是什么样的。
责任编辑:MK
标签:NFTFTXTOKTOKENFT IndexMOONCAT Vault (NFTX)Gengar TokenZum Token
10月27日,AptosAutumn主网上线一周后,其浏览器数据显示,该Layer1网络的交易总量为1432万笔,TPS为10.65,原生TokenAPT总供应量约为10.02亿,质押数量约为8.23亿枚,活跃节点数量102个.
1900/1/1 0:00:00作者简介:Yudee,WXY营销咨询公司创始人。拥有超过15年的市场营销经验,曾在奥美、腾讯、36Kr、美团等平台任职.
1900/1/1 0:00:00目前有大量的rollup项目,它们处于不同的发展阶段。这些项目共有的一个模式是使用了临时辅助轮:虽然项目的技术仍然不成熟,但为了发展生态的目的,便选择了提前启动,而不是完全依赖其欺诈证明或ZK证明,然后有某种多重签名能够在代码中存在漏.
1900/1/1 0:00:00本以为FTX的暴雷破产,会让交易所洗牌盘整,泡沫进一步挤压,整个行业会“重焕生机”。一觉醒来看到一姐YiHe吹雷预警和大家对CZ的漫天指责,瞬感那个被CEX长期占领话语权高地的Crypto行业可能要进一步“失控”了.
1900/1/1 0:00:00编者按:过去几十年里,互联网是一片新大陆,而这些巨头像是东印度公司,到了新大陆一看到处都是数字农奴,他们可以为所欲为.
1900/1/1 0:00:00自8月份以来,推特上的KOL对RealYield的讨论越来越激烈。这一讨论的起源和爆火与GMX在熊市里出色的表现相吻合.
1900/1/1 0:00:00